7A -5:30P Wed- Sat Number of Beds – Facility features 28 bed IRF and 383 acute care hospital (avg census 240) Number of Staff – 15 OT’s on staff (F/T, P/T, and PRN staff) Type of staff: Day Shift – Staffed to support patient care needs Night Shift – NONE Patient Ratios – 4 patients/day (IRF) 8-12 patients/day (acute care) Type of equipment – 2 therapy gyms, ADL apartment EMR – Meditech Typical hiring profile Skill Set Most recruited for: Must have: candidates without these skills will not be considered for the role. Weekend flexibility Willingness to work on IRF unit Critical thinking/clinical reasoning Preferred or nice to have: candidates with these skills will be considered first. Hospital/IRF experience (highly preferred) Stroke/neuro experience List typical procedures performed on unit(s): Evaluation, treatment, discharge Team conferences, family training Adaptive devices, adaptive equipment Best personality Fit: Flexible, team player, collaborative Unit Guidelines/Policies: Please feel free to attach unit policies and guidelines. 1 weekend shift/month MINUMUM. Highly prefer increased weekend flexibility Active OT license, active BLS certification

Norfolk, Virginia, is another nearby city that provides a compatible atmosphere for Occupational Therapists. The city’s pay scale is generally in line with Portsmouth, with salaries around $58,000 to $78,000 depending on experience. Norfolk’s cost of living is slightly lower, and housing options range from waterfront condos to affordable townhomes. The city’s coastal climate ensures mild winters and warm summers, perfect for outdoor activities, while its dynamic cultural life includes festivals, museums, and a growing culinary scene, enhancing the lifestyle appeal.

Virginia Beach, a coastal city just south of Portsmouth, also presents a favorable landscape for Occupational Therapists. The salary range is slightly higher, averaging between $62,000 and $82,000, making it a strong competitor in the healthcare field. The cost of living parallels that of Norfolk, providing residents with a variety of housing options from beachfront properties to suburban homes. The lifestyle in Virginia Beach is notably relaxed, with a strong emphasis on outdoor activities, including access to beautiful beaches, parks, and recreational facilities, making it attractive for those who enjoy an active lifestyle.

Chesapeake, Virginia, shares many characteristics with Portsmouth, particularly in terms of job opportunities for Occupational Therapists. The pay range is similar, generally falling between $60,000 and $75,000 annually, while the cost of living is quite reasonable, making it an appealing choice for healthcare professionals. Housing options are abundant, with neighborhoods perfect for families and single professionals alike. The climate is similar to Portsmouth’s, with warm summers and mild winters, and residents can enjoy ample outdoor spaces and local attractions, fostering a sense of community and work-life balance.
